Output 3d813841775d2914a27c81248e4960f1cf1be8677de16541e1f08d5dfa041191:9

value
405000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ffedce11c8a3edebbbe02bd97d3c0ab629dfd3c2 OP_EQUAL
address
MXEPRKp54VWw5eQLrHxufQ3XfsDs8JEmzZ
transaction
3d813841775d2914a27c81248e4960f1cf1be8677de16541e1f08d5dfa041191
spent
true